The cruise control on Your 2005 Honda CR-V is like many electronically controlled systems in Your car. The cruise control has a corresponding fuse that will blow to protect the system if it senses a short circuit. When the fuse for the cruise control blows, the cruise control will stop working altogether.The brake pedal switch turns on the vehicle's brake lights when it senses that the brake pedal has been pressed. Because cruise control systems have been designed to disengage when the brake pedal is pressed, the cruise control is wired to the brake pedal switch. If the brake pedal switch fails, the car may think the brakes are engaged and not allow the cruise control system to turn on.
